What Is a Hob?
A hob, typically referred to as a cooktop or range top, is the flat surface on which pots and pans are placed for cooking. Hobs are geared up with heating components that generate the needed heat for cooking food. They come in different kinds, consisting of gas, electric, induction, and ceramic options. Each type provides distinct advantages and drawbacks.
Kinds of Hobs
Gas Hobs:
- Heat Source: Natural gas or propane.
- Benefits: Instant heat control and responsiveness, preferred by numerous chefs for exact cooking.
- Drawbacks: Requires a gas connection and can be less energy-efficient.
Electric Hobs:
- Heat Source: Electric coils or smooth glass-ceramic surfaces.
- Benefits: Generally much easier to clean up, even heating, and extensively readily available.
- Downsides: Slower to warm up and cool down compared to gas.
Induction Hobs:
- Heat Source: Electromagnetic currents.
- Benefits: Quick heating, energy-efficient, and just heats up the cookware, not the surrounding surface area.
- Downsides: Requires compatible pots and pans (ferrous products).
Ceramic Hobs:
- Heat Source: Electric and has a smooth glass surface area.
- Benefits: Sleek appearance, easy to clean, and even heating.
- Downsides: Can take longer to warm up and cool off.
What Is an Oven?
An oven is an enclosed home appliance that cooks food by surrounding it with dry heat. Ovens can be standalone units or combined with hobs in a single device referred to as a variety. Ovens are versatile tools that can be utilized for baking, roasting, broiling, and more.
Types of Ovens
Conventional Ovens:
- Heat Source: Electric or gas.
- Benefits: Good for standard baking and roasting.
- Drawbacks: Can have irregular heat distribution.
Convection Ovens:
- Heat Source: Electric or gas with a fan for flowing air.
- Benefits: More even cooking and much faster cooking times due to airflow.
- Drawbacks: Can be costlier and might need changes in cooking times.
Microwave Ovens:
- Heat Source: Microwaves.
- Advantages: Quick cooking and reheating; excellent for thawing.
- Disadvantages: Can not brown or crisp food well.
Steam Ovens:
- Heat Source: Steam generation.
- Advantages: Retains nutrients and moisture in food, much healthier cooking choice.
- Disadvantages: Longer cooking times and normally greater expense.
Secret Differences Between Hobs and Ovens
While hobs and ovens serve the main purpose of cooking food, their functionalities and uses differ substantially. The following table summarizes these key differences:
Feature | Hob | Oven |
---|---|---|
Cooking Method | Direct heat | Enclosed heat |
Primary Use | Boiling, sautéing, frying | Baking, roasting |
Heat Source | Gas, electric, induction | Gas, electric, steam |
Cooking Area | Flat surface area | Enclosed area |
Cooking Time | Typically much faster | Differs based on meal |
Control & & Precision | Immediate and direct | Depend on settings and timers |

Upkeep and Care
To make sure the durability of hobs and ovens, routine maintenance is essential. Here are some suggestions:
For Hobs:
- Clean spills immediately to prevent staining.
- Usage suitable cleaners for specific materials (e.g., ceramic cleaner for glass-ceramic hobs).
- Routinely check gas connections for leakages (for gas hobs).
For Ovens:
- Wipe down the interior after each usage to prevent build-up.
- Usage self-cleaning features if offered, or use oven cleaners for difficult discolorations.
- Routinely inspect seals and gaskets for wear and tear (to maintain heat effectiveness).
FAQs About Hobs and Ovens
1. What is the very best type of hob for a beginner cook?
Answer: A ceramic or electric hob is frequently suggested for newbies due to relieve of use and cleansing.
2. Can I use any cookware on an induction hob?
Response: No, induction hobs require pots and pans made from magnetic products (e.g., cast iron or stainless-steel).
3. How frequently should I clean my oven?
Response: It is advisable to clean your oven every couple of months, or more often if you use it typically.
4. Is it much better to bake in a stove?
Response: Yes, convection ovens are frequently much better for baking as they provide even heat distribution. Nevertheless, some delicate dishes might take advantage of traditional ovens.
